The Scottish Rugby Union (SRU) governs rugby union in Scotland, as the second oldest Rugby Union, having been founded in 1873. It oversees the national league system, known as the Scottish League Championship, and the Scottish National teams.
The Scotland national rugby team represents Scotland in international rugby union. They participate annually in the Six Nations Championship, along with the Rugby World Cup, which takes place every four years. The history of the team extends back to 1871, when they played their first official test match, winning 1–0 against England. They maintain a strong rivalry with the English national team, with both teams competing annually for the Calcutta Cup as part of the Six Nations Championship. Scotland traditionally wear navy blue jerseys, white shorts and blue socks. They play their home matches at Murrayfield Stadium.
